Regionale Unterschiede

Elevation and proximity to the sea matter. Low-lying valleys and clear-sky rural areas cool fastest at night. Urban centers often stay a few degrees warmer (urban heat island effect). That means the same date can feel like frost in one town and a chilly but frost-free morning 20 kilometers away.

Expect a mix: nights dipping below 0°C in many inland pockets, daytime temperatures ranging from about -2°C to +6°C depending on sun and wind. Wie verlässlich sind die Vorhersagen?

Forecast confidence is highest for the next 48–72 hours; beyond that models diverge more. For planning, short-term local forecasts plus real-time observations win. Praktische Tipps — was Sie jetzt tun können

  • Check morning temps before leaving plants outside; bring sensitive potted plants indoors or cover them overnight.
  • Insulate exposed water pipes and drain garden hoses to avoid freezing damage.
  • Allow extra travel time; frost can make roads deceptively slippery at dawn.
  • Set heating schedules smartly — lower at night but avoid deep temperature drops that stress pipes.

Spezielle Hinweise für Landwirte und Gärtner

Frost can damage blossoms and young shoots. Consider frost-protection measures like row covers, anti-frost fans, or low-intensity overhead irrigation (used carefully). Local agricultural extensions and meteorological advisories often publish targeted guidance.

Was zu beobachten ist (Kurzfristig)

Watch for: clear nights after calm winds (higher frost risk), sudden shifts in wind direction (can warm or cool an area fast), and model consensus tightening around a cold block — that often signals several reliable frost nights ahead.
